While some may think that any electrician can manage all circuitry problems, there are important legal and technical distinctions in between a regular electrician and one with Level 2 Accreditation. Newtown's varied architectural landscape, that includes a mix of historical balcony homes and modern-day industrial buildings, presents unique challenges that require customized know-how. The older structures in Newtown frequently have actually outdated service merges and overhead power lines that do not fulfill existing safety standards or the power requirements of modern appliances.
A certified Newtown Level 2 Electrician is capable of dealing with tasks associated with the connection point in between the regional electrical power network and a private property. This includes crucial obligations like disconnecting and reconnecting buildings from the main power grid, along with installing or repairing underground and overhead service lines and addressing complicated metering needs. While regular electricians typically concentrate on internal electrical wiring past the switchboard, Level 2 professionals are the only ones authorized by law to work on high voltage lines or the infrastructure supplying power to the home.
House owners in Newtown often need the services of a Level 2 Electrician to update their electrical supply to 3 phase power. The increasing adoption of electric lorries and high-capacity air conditioning systems has resulted in a rise in demand for more robust electrical infrastructure, as single phase supplies often have a hard time to satisfy the increased energy requirements. By upgrading to 3 phase power, citizens can enjoy a stable and trustworthy electrical energy supply, minimizing the probability of electrical faults and disruptions throughout durations of high use. Nevertheless, this upgrade process is complex and requires close collaboration with the regional energy supplier, highlighting the requirement for a knowledgeable electrician with in-depth knowledge of the regional network. A qualified professional will guarantee that all work is performed in compliance with the New South Wales Service and Setup Guidelines, protecting homeowner from prospective legal threats and guaranteeing the long-term efficiency and security of their electrical system.
